Abstract
This invention relates to a process for producing collagenase, which comprises aerobically cultivating a collagenase-producing bacterium belonging to the genus Bacillus, and recovering collagenase from the culture broth. This invention also provides a thermophilic bacterium of the genus Bacillus which has the ability to produce collagenase and which grows at a temperature of 42.degree. to 74.degree. C. and a pH of 5.0 to 9.0 and a novel thermophilic collagenase which does not substantially lose collagenase activity even when maintained for 1 hour at a temperature of 60.degree. C. in the presence of a calcium ion at a pH in the range of 6.5 to 8.5, and which has a molecular weight, determined by gel filtration, between those of cytochrome C and ovalbumin.
